This report examines the failures of Human Resource Management (HRM) practices within multinational corporations (MNCs) when operating in international environments. It highlights that a primary reason for these failures is a lack of understanding of the cultural norms and labor laws specific to each foreign environment. The report contrasts international HRM with domestic HRM, noting the increased complexity and external factors involved in managing a diverse, globally distributed workforce. Key challenges include compliance with varying labor laws and adapting HR practices to different cultural contexts. The report concludes by emphasizing the importance of ongoing training and development, and adherence to local regulations to enhance employee productivity and organizational goals.
